Although Lil Wayne hasn’t released any new material, he’s still breaking records on the Billboard music charts. Thanks to Wale releasing his new single, “Running Back,” of which he appears on, Weezy now holds the record of having the most Billboard Hot 100 entries than any other solo artist in the chart’s 58-year history.

Wayne’s debut on “Running Back,” which premiered at No. 100 on the Hot 100 chart, marks his 133rd hit among soloists. The Young Money leader actually beat his artist-friend Drake who has 132 chart appearances.

But in terms of all acts, solo and group, the cast of Glee holds the supreme record with 207 visits on the Billboard Hot 100 chart.

However, Lil Wayne’s chart achievement will probably be short-lived since Drizzy is poised to drop his More Life playlist. There’s no question that one or more songs from that project will eventually grace the Hot 100 tally and add to his chart totals.

Nevertheless, this is an impressive feat for Lil Wayne who has been slow with dropping new music. Of course, that's because of his ongoing legal battle with Cash Money Records, which has put a damper on his musical activities.
